debatably

Upper-Intermediate (B2)

IPA: /dɪˈbeɪtəblɪ/

KK: /dɪˈbeɪtəbli/

adverb
Definition

In a manner that can be argued or questioned; open to discussion.


Example

The proposal is debatably the best option for the project.

Root Explanation

Debatably → It is formed from "debate" (from Old French *debattre*, meaning to fight or contend) and the suffix "-ably" (meaning in a manner that can be). The word "debatably" means in a manner that can be debated or argued.
